In the mid-1960s, the art world underwent a seismic shift, moving away from the heavy, emotional introspection of Abstract Expressionism toward something far more immediate and accessible. At the heart of this revolution stood Roy Lichtenstein, whose 1966 masterpiece, "Pop," serves as a definitive emblem of this era. The painting is not merely a visual arrangement; it is an energetic explosion of color and form that captures the pulse of mid-century consumer culture. Featuring a bold, stark white letter ‘P’ that seems to burst forth from a sea of crimson, the work is framed by stylized bubbles in striking shades of blue and red. This dynamic composition creates a sense of kinetic movement, as if the very alphabet itself has been caught in a moment of high-velocity transformation, making it an irresistible centerpiece for any modern interior.
The brilliance of "Pop" lies in its deceptive simplicity. While the subject matter—a single character and geometric shapes—appears straightforward, Lichtenstein’s technique reveals a profound mastery of Ben-Day printing. This method, borrowed from the industrial world of comic books and newspaper advertisements, utilizes tiny, meticulously placed dots to create shading, texture, and an illusion of depth. By translating a mechanical process onto a fine art canvas, Lichtenstein achieved a luminous quality that defies the flatness often associated with the Pop Art movement. To look upon "Pop" is to witness a deliberate dialogue between the gallery space and the street. Lichtenstein’s choice of imagery—the iconic, singular letter—draws directly from the lexicon of advertising and mass communication. During an era defined by the rapid rise of television and glossy print media, this painting acted as a mirror to a society increasingly shaped by brand identity and graphic impact. The symbolism within the work transcends the literal; the "explosion" of the letter represents the transformative power of innovation and the way commercial symbols can be elevated to the status of high art. It is a celebration of the beauty found in the mundane, inviting viewers to find aesthetic value in the very tools of mass production.
